We would like to inform you about the video surveillance system installed in February 2024 at the headquarters of the South Tyrol Museum of Archaeology.
Data controller: Angelika Fleckinger, Department of Provincial Museums
Privacy delegate for the entity that carries out video surveillance: Elisabeth Vallazza
Purpose
The video surveillance system was installed for needs related to:
- prevention of theft, robbery, damage, vandalism;
- protection and safeguarding of heritage;
- prevention of abuse;
- prevention of criminal acts that may occur.
In the event of such unlawful acts, if necessary, the images may be made available to the competent authorities, even if they contain images of employees.
Special information (signs) were also installed before accessing each video-supervised area.
The images will be stored for a period of 3 days, and in any case not longer than 7 days, as provided for by law in the Provision on Video Surveillance.
